Should You Tie Braid To A Swivel?

Use the Braid Knot to Connect a Swivel to Braided Line Even so, this knot like all knots, must be tied with care. Pull it up slowly and evenly so that the loops snug up neatly and don’t overlap. If it doesn’t look right – one of the loops is looser than the others for example – cut it off and start again.

What knot is best for braided line?

Palomar Knot : Because the line is doubled over when passed through the eye of the hook, the Palomar knot is often considered to be the best terminal knot to use with braided line.

Is Palomar knot good for braided line?

The Palomar knot is a simple, but very strong and effective, knot. It is recommended for use with braided lines , and is so simple that with a little practice it can be tied in the dark. It is regarded as one of the strongest and most reliable fishing knots.

Is the Trilene Knot good for braided line?

The Trilene Knot usually tests at 95 percent or more of the unknotted line. It’s a proven knot for use with monofilament and fluorocarbon, and with Nylon and Dacron braids, but it is not an acceptable choice for gel-spun braided lines.

Should you use a leader with braided line?

You need to connect a leader to your braided line if you are fishing rough grounds or

super clear waters

, or if you are targeting sharp-toothed fish like flounder, bluefish, or the sharks Apart from that, it should be okay to use straight braid without expecting any problems.

What is the strongest braid to mono knot?

Generally speaking, the best knot to tie braid to mono leader is considered to be the Double Uni Knot While the Double Uni Knot is one of the simplest line-to-line connections that can be used with two lines of relatively similar diameter, there are a few other knots that you may want to try in certain situations.

How do you tie a swivel to a leader?

To tie a swivel to your fishing line, try using an improved clinch knot First, thread the line through the swivel and double it back. Then, twist the line 5 or 7 times and feed the end through the loop created by your twists. Finally, pull the short end and the main line to tighten your knot.

What is a Bimini twist knot used for?

The Bimini twist knot is used to form a strong section of double line when offshore fishing Because the Bimini twist fishing knot acts as a shock absorber, it is one of the best knots to use for saltwater big game species. Learn more about when and how to tie the Bimini twist in this section.

Should I use a swivel when fishing?

The best rule of thumb when deciding whether to use a swivel or steel leader is to decide if the line will be twisting during the retrieve of a lure or the playing of the fish. Most lures, such as a crankbait, will not twist on the retrieve, so a swivel is not required.

Should your leader be stronger than your main line?

Go with a stronger leader line if you’re concerned with abrasion Go with a weaker leader line if you’re concerned with line visibility and castability. Either the mainline or leader line strength should exceed the rod’s rated strength. Selecting the right strength for your leader is a trail-by-error process.

Does braided line need backing?

When you’re putting braided line on your spinning reel, you always want to add some mono backing to the reel first Mono grips into the arbor (the center of the spool) much better than braid does and pretty much guarantees you won’t have issues with the line free spinning when you get a fish on.
